Basics
Dice Slider is a fast and addictive dice game. Players use five
dice to create various combinations in order to complete the
twelve given fields. (111, 222, 333, 444, 555, 666, one pair,
all different, full house, any combo, 4 of a kind and 5 of a kind).
In order to complete a level, players must complete each of the
twelve fields, and score enough points to get to the next level.
The amount of points required for the next level is increased
each level.
Players get two rolls per field. You roll the dice and then select which die (or
dice) to hold to create the appropriate combination. Once you
have the combination you need, you may clear it from the board
by clicking it. When completing a field, the player again has two
rolls, regardless of how many rolls they used to complete the previous
field.
The game ends when you have no rolls left, cant complete a required
combinations, or havent accumulated enough points to go to the next
level.
Scoring
Points are awarded for each field completed. The amount of points awarded
for a given field may differ depending on the dice combination. For example
the "111" field will give you 3 points if you have only three "1"'s in
your dice combination. If you hae four "1"'s, you will receive 75 points, the
amount of points usually awarded for a "4 of a kind". Five "1"'s will net
you 100 points, the same as "5 of a kind". Three "1"'s and a pair will net
you 50 points, the same as a "full house".

There are twelve different combinations. They are listed below along
with the point value below.
| Combinations |
Point Value |
Max Point Value |
| 1 1 1 |
3 |
100 |
| 2 2 2 |
6 |
100 |
| 3 3 3 |
9 |
100 |
| 4 4 4 |
12 |
100 |
| 5 5 5 |
15 |
100 |
| 6 6 6 |
18 |
100 |
| One Pair |
10 |
100 |
| All Different |
40 |
40 |
| Full House |
50 |
100 |
| Any Combo |
30 |
30 |
| 4 of a Kind |
75 |
100 |
| 5 of a Kind |
100 |
100 |
| Total: |
368 |
1070 |
